Common Questions About Hiring a White Collar Crime Lawyer
When is the right time to hire a white collar crime lawyer?The instant you sense federal agents are watching you, retaining counsel is the right move. Waiting until you are indicted can cost you defenses that would otherwise be available. Having counsel before charges can sometimes prevent prosecution entirely.
Does it matter if my case is in federal or state court?The distinction is critical. U.S. attorneys pursue cases in federal district court and often result in longer sentences. State-level matters unfold in superior court and may offer more flexibility in resolution. A white collar crime lawyer with experience in state and federal court is best positioned to defend you.
Is a white collar crime lawyer expensive?White collar defense range widely depending on the investigation's scale. A straightforward state-level matter may cost less than cases involving millions of pages of discovery. What you spend on quality legal defense is almost always less when measured against fines, imprisonment, and professional consequences attached to a guilty verdict.
Is it possible to beat a white collar charge?Positive outcomes including case dismissal happen regularly in white collar defense when the defense is aggressive and well-prepared. Common grounds for dismissal include entrapment, statute of limitations issues, and failure to prove criminal intent beyond a reasonable doubt. Every case is different and no counsel should promise a specific outcome, but the odds shift significantly with a proven legal team.
Will my professional license be affected if I am charged with a white collar crime?Professional licensing boards governing healthcare, legal, and financial professionals often take independent action even before a case resolves in court. A white collar crime lawyer who understands the interplay between criminal charges and regulatory standing can get more info develop a parallel strategy while defending the criminal case.
